单词 | abut |
---|---|
音标 | 英[əˈbʌt] 美[əˈbʌt] |
解释 | vt.& vi.(与…)邻接;(与…)毗连;接触;倚靠; |
例句 | VERB 邻接;毗连;紧靠 When land or a building abuts something or abuts on something, it is next to it. 例:One edge of the garden abutted on an old entrance to the mine...花园的一侧紧靠着矿井的旧入口。 例:He was born in 1768 in the house abutting our hotel.他于1768年出生于我们旅馆旁边的一幢房子里。 |
变形 | third:abuts~done:abutted~ing:abutting~past:abutted~ |
